Position Posting: Miami ARTCC Training Administrator
Date Posted: December 9th, 2025
Submission Deadline: Until position is filled (will update this post accordingly)

Purpose:
The Miami ARTCC is seeking a motivated individual to serve as the Miami ARTCC Training Administrator.

Key Responsibilities:
- Reports to and serves at the pleasure of the Miami ARTCC Air Traffic Manager and VATUSA3
- Maintains an online presence within the facility and on the VATSIM network
- Operates as a Miami ARTCC senior staff member and attends meetings as required
- Manages and creates training material for both home and visiting controllers in accordance with VATUSA and VATSIM guidelines
- Oversees the day-to-day operation of the training department
- Leads and develops a team of mentors and instructors
- Other duties as assigned or delegated by the Miami ARTCC ATM

Requirements:
- Must be eligible to hold an I3 rating
- Must be an active member of the VATSIM network in good standing with no significant disciplinary history within the past 12 months
- Must have a strong knowledge of the United States National Airspace System and Air Traffic Control systems
- Must have current or previous VATSIM training experience
- Must have excellent written and oral communication skills
- Must be able to work in a team environment and effectively manage a large team
- Demonstrate strong leadership qualities

Preferred Skills (not required):
- Leadership, managerial, or supervisory experience (real-world or VATSIM applicable)
- Familiarity with Miami ARTCC policies and procedures
- Demonstrate the qualities of understanding, patience, restraint, and professionalism
